The locals enjoy meeting outsiders: and as we live in a safe area, folks are generally out and about doing their visiting until about 8 p.m. And in mentioning this, please understand that this is a very rural, typical mountain community that wakes with the rooster's crow, and sleeps with the coming of the star-filled, quiet night. It gathers and chops firewood for cooking, keeps chickens, rides horses and mules to work, washes clothes by hand, build houses from hand-made adobes, and plants everything by hand without tractors. There are very few places to shop, and no restaurants.

    That being said, the are daily busses that come and go to the larger towns outide of these mountains. The bus rates are cheap, and it is easy to get out to explore: or, get up further into the mountains to wander the forests and rivers.

    Nature lovers are encouraged to enjoy trips to the river, and hiking excursions in the mountains, as well as outings to pick mangos, oranges or whatever the seasonal fruit may be. Playing soccer is another favorite pastime here in the village.

    The sunrises, sunsets, and summer thunderstorms here tend to be amazing.
    Camping is easy to arrange in the mountain forests.

    There are a few daily busses that come and go from the nearest town an hour away, as well as to the next larger town 2 hours away. Bus fare is $1.50-$3 each way. The new international airport XPL is an easy 2-3 hour bus ride from home. I am about 4 hours from Tegucigalpa, 4 hours from San Pedro Sula, and 2 hours from Siguatepeque.
